These refractory solutions find extensive application across heavy industries including steel manufacturing, cement production, power generation, glass manufacturing, and chemical processing plants. In steel mills, they line blast furnaces and reheating furnaces where temperatures exceed standard limits. Cement plants utilize them for rotary kiln linings and preheater towers requiring thermal stability. Power generation facilities rely on them for boiler maintenance and repair operations. The glass industry uses these materials for furnace construction and maintenance, while chemical plants employ them in high-temperature reactors and processing units.
